What is a LCSW?
LCSW represents licensed medical social worker. They are social workers who have actually gone on to get their master’s in social work (MSW) and complete the requirements in their state to acquire their expert license. By getting their MSW and license, they can work in a variety of environments, check out various specializations, and even open their own private practice.

What does a Certified Scientific Social Worker Do?
A licensed scientific social worker offers treatment to customers with emotional and mental issuesExternal link: open_in_new that are affecting their lives. They work with their clients to listen to their requirements and supply the support and resources needed to deal with those problems.

LCSWs likewise have the capability to detect and treat the problems of their clients, although this may differ by state. This can be in the form of offering therapy, supplying recommendations, and dealing with other experts like physicians to come up with a reliable treatment plan for their customer.

Where do LCSWs work?
LCSWs can operate in a selection of settings. Some work in offices for research study purposes, and others might visit their customers in schools, their home, recreation center, healthcare facilities, helped living facilities, and more. The workplace of an LCSW differs depending on their area of specialization.

Is a LCSW considered a doctor?
Unlike a medical professional, an LCSW can not prescribe medication. LCSWs have the ability to supply psychiatric therapy to their customers, nevertheless, their training focuses on connecting their clients with the resources and abilities required to fulfill their needs. LCSWs can easily collaborate with physicians and psychiatrists to establish comprehensive treatment prepare for clients. In those cases, psychiatrists or medical professionals might be responsible for prescribing medication.

While those in the field of psychiatry can go on to medical school and make their Doctor of Medicine, the master’s in social work (MSW) is the highest level of education that LCSWs acquire. However depending upon an LCSW’s career goals, they might choose to complete a DSW program down the line.

Just how much does a LCSW make?
Since May 2020, the average yearly wage for social workers was $51,760 External link: open_in_new, according to the BLS. The income of an LCSW differs based upon elements such as their company, specialized, and the quantity of time they work. Lots of social workers tend to work full-time, however some might be on call.

A psychologist is a social researcher who is trained to study human habits and psychological procedures. Psychologists can work in a range of research or scientific settings. Psychology degrees are offered at all levels: bachelor’s, master’s, or doctorate (PhD or PsyD). Postgraduate degree and licensing are required for those in independent practice or who use patient care, including clinical, therapy and school psychologists.

PhD programs in clinical psychology emphasize theory and research study approaches and prepare trainees for either academic work or careers as practitioners. The PsyD, which was produced in the late 1960s to resolve a shortage of professionals, stresses training in therapy and counseling. Psychologists with either degree can practice therapy however are needed to finish a number of years of monitored practice prior to ending up being licensed.

A psychologist will diagnose a mental disorder or problem and identify what’s best for the client’s care. A psychologist frequently operates in tandem with a psychiatrist, who is likewise a medical doctor and can recommend medication if it is figured out that medication is needed for a patient’s treatment. Psychologists can do research study, which is a really important contribution academically and medically, to the occupation.
